F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
||||
|
||||
¿Por qué no te cambias a un lenguaje "moderno"?
Compañeros...
En estas fechas estoy intentando resolver un tema de firmas para poder enviar facturas electrónicas a la plataforma "face" mediante webservice, la verdad es que sin mucho resultado. Mirando por la red veo que las herramientas de microsoft tienen de forma nativa componentes para resolver estos temas en los que yo estoy bastante pegado, me acuerdo de un conocido que desarrolla con .NET, lo llamo para preguntarle por el asunto y me dice que no me puede ayudar pero que si, que con .NET se pueden manejar firmas y certificados de forma nativa y me dice el jodío....¿por qué no te cambias ya a un lenguaje moderno?
__________________
Be water my friend. |
#2
|
||||
|
||||
No estoy al tanto del tema de esos certificados, pero sobre lo que dice esa persona:
https://jonlennartaasenden.wordpress...-about-delphi/ https://translate.google.com/transla...bout-delphi%2F Es lo que tiene la ignorancia. Párrafo del enlace anterior: Cita:
La ley es muy simple: cada nivel solo puede emitir complejidad hacia arriba. Entonces el ensamblador se usa para producir C y pascal. C y pascal se usa para producir C++ y Object Pascal. C++ y Object Pascal se usan para producir cada otra pieza de tecnología que se da por sentada.
__________________
La otra guía de estilo | Búsquedas avanzadas | Etiquetas para código | Colabora mediante Paypal |
#3
|
||||
|
||||
Cita:
¿O de verdad hay algo que no dependa de OpenSSL o .NET, código fuente realmente moderno (no en C), humanamente escrito en archivos .pas u otro lenguaje moderno como Delphi, para estos menesteres? |
#4
|
|||
|
|||
Hola, Ya existen soluciones para trabajar con certificados e implementados.
Bambucode ha desarrollado una librería pra trabajar con XML, leer un certificado y sellarlo. Se usa el DLL del openSSL. Y usa webservices para el timbrado con la dependencia fiscal, en le caso de méxico con el SAT. hxxps://github.com/bambucode/tfacturaelectronica Puedes tomar el ejemplo y aplicarlo tu mismo para eso. Tambien puedes checar esta librería TurboPower Lockbox 3 (es una versión completamente nueva, muy avanzada y diferente de TP lockbox 2). hxxp://lockbox.seanbdurkin.id.au/HomePage hxxps://github.com/SeanBDurkin/tplockbox Ese ya implementa muchas soluciones que se necesitan para los certificados, si les gusta el proyecto hagan una donación para que se pueda seguir trabajando con la librería. NO veo el problema de usar Librerías externas a delphi, .NET tambien lo hace, así que eso de que .NET ya trae funciones es es algo relativo, con .NET siempre vas a depender que tu Framework pueda ser ejecutado en el ambiente en el que trabaje la máquina. Con las DLL de openssl eso no es necesario. Última edición por Casimiro Notevi fecha: 21-06-2018 a las 11:17:35. Razón: Poner enlaces. |
#5
|
||||
|
||||
Cita:
__________________
Be water my friend. |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Usar TServerSocket y TClientSocket para enviar "streams" más o menos "grandes" | dec | Internet | 9 | 04-08-2015 17:11:50 |
Cual es el "mejor" lenguaje? Un comparador | mamcx | Debates | 2 | 10-06-2013 22:44:54 |
Google lanzará un nuevo lenguaje de programación, llamado "Dart" | MAXIUM | Noticias | 59 | 30-03-2012 01:17:53 |
Error "Oxygene no es un lenguaje admitido" | mamen | .NET | 0 | 28-05-2010 13:44:10 |
¿Es legal comprar un lenguaje delphi de "segunda mano"? | rrf | Varios | 6 | 20-12-2009 20:06:19 |
|